Ringgold, GA – Serious Pedestrian Accident with Injuries in SB Lanes of I-75

4/13 Ringgold, GA – Serious Pedestrian Accident with Injuries in SB Lanes of I-75

Ringgold, GA (April 13, 2023) – Around 4:30 p.m. on the afternoon of Thursday, April 13, a serious pedestrian accident with injuries occurred in Ringgold.

According to Catoosa County officials, the accident happened in the southbound lanes of I-75 around the area of exit 353, Cloud Springs Road. Police confirmed that a pedestrian was walking in the area when they were suddenly struck by a passenger vehicle due to reasons that are not yet known. It is believed that the driver of the vehicle remained on the scene.

Paramedics, fire crews, and several other responders were immediately dispatched to the scene to help those in need. The pedestrian, who has not yet been formally identified, was seriously injured in the accident. They were rushed to the hospital for treatment of unknown injuries.

The roadway was blocked in the southbound lanes of traffic. Police worked to clear the scene as quickly as possible.

No further details have been released, but the investigation continues.

Pedestrian Accidents in Georgia 

Georgia has seen a steady and unfortunate increase in pedestrian accidents over recent years. In fact, thousands of people are injured in pedestrian accidents, and many others lose their lives. In just 2021 alone, in fact, it was reported that approximately 348 people were killed in fatal pedestrian accidents, and many others sustained injuries throughout all of Georgia. Pedestrian accidents occur in the blink of an eye due to many different reasons, which include the following:

  • Distracted driving, such as texting behind the wheel
  • Drunk or drugged driving
  • Speeding
  • Fatigued driving
